Michelle Obama determined to protect kids

WASHINGTON, Jan. 17 (UPI) -- U.S. President-elect Barack Obama's wife Michelle intends to keep her daughters' lives as normal as possible during their White House stay, an author says.

"The Presidents' Wives" author Robert Watson said Michelle Obama wants Malia, 10, and Sasha, 7, to enjoy relatively normal lives despite the fact their father will be president of the United States, the New York Daily News reported Saturday.

"She's made references that her pet project is her children," Watson said. "She wants to give them a sense of normalcy, to not miss PTA meetings and soccer practices."

While Watson recognized Michelle Obama will have to watch her public comments during her husband's presidency, he is confident she will maintain a delicate order in the White House.

"I think Michelle will have her cake and eat it too," he told the Daily News, "and will address related issues, like drug use and racism. She'll frame her activities under the rubric of motherhood."
